ACI Worldwide FCF Margin % Calculation

FCF margin is the ratio of Free Cash Flow divided by net sales or Revenue, usually presented in percent.

ACI Worldwide's FCF Margin for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

FCF Margin=Free Cash Flow (A: Dec. 2025 )/Revenue (A: Dec. 2025 )
=247.215/1502.854
=16.45 %

ACI Worldwide's FCF Margin for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 is calculated as

FCF Margin=Free Cash Flow (Q: Jun. 2026 )/Revenue (Q: Jun. 2026 )
=49.542/373.607
=13.26 %

ACI Worldwide Business Description

Other Exchanges ACIW:USA
Address 6060 Coventry Drive, Elkhorn, NE, USA, 68022-6482
ACI Worldwide Inc develops, markets, and installs a portfolio of software products focused on facilitating electronic payments. The firm's products are sold and supported directly and through distribution networks covering three geographic regions - the Americas, EMEA, and Asia Pacific. ACI software products process payment transactions for retail banking clients, billers such as utilities and healthcare providers, and community banks and credit unions. ACI's customers are financial institutions all over the world, but the majority of the revenue is generated in the United States and EMEA regions. The company's operating segment includes Payment Software and Biller. The company generates the majority of its revenue from the Payment Software segment.
